  • 🏝An organized, unincorporated territory of the United States in the western Pacific Ocean, forming the largest and southernmost island of the Marianas.
  • 🏳️What does its flag mean? The deep blue field represents the vast waters of the Pacific Ocean surrounding Guam, while the red border symbolizes the blood spilled by the indigenous Chamorro people during colonial occupation and World War II. The oval seal — shaped like a traditional Chamorro sling stone used in hunting and warfare — depicts Agana Bay, a coconut tree symbolizing self-sustenance, and a traditional proa outrigger sailboat representing navigation skills.
  • 🌅Where America's day begins: Guam's official slogan is 'Where America's Day Begins' because it is located on the west side of the International Date Line, making it the first US territory to see each new calendar day.
  • 🐍The brown tree snake phenomenon: After being accidentally introduced via cargo ships after WWII, the brown tree snake population boomed, leading to the near-extinction of almost all native forest bird species on the island.
  • 🏺Prehistoric latte stones: Guam is famous for latte stones, ancient stone pillars with hemispherical capstones built by the indigenous Chamorro people starting around 800 AD as foundations for elevated homes.
